# HG changeset patch # User John D # Date 1511988653 18000 # Node ID 7e8c6bb47c21eb0bc0be687b8cbefe700bf93482 # Parent 91cbefb72c4000ffceef1dd8a2efc5d6aa463740 update: additional pkg update updates * src/dbus.mk, src/gst-plugins-base.mk, src/gst-plugins-good.mk, src/gstreamer.mk, src/harfbuzz.mk, src/liboil.mk, src/netcdf.mk, src/protobuf.mk: update PKG_UPDATE macro diff -r 91cbefb72c40 -r 7e8c6bb47c21 src/dbus.mk --- a/src/dbus.mk Wed Nov 29 11:01:36 2017 -0500 +++ b/src/dbus.mk Wed Nov 29 15:50:53 2017 -0500 @@ -12,7 +12,7 @@ define $(PKG)_UPDATE $(WGET) -q -O- 'http://cgit.freedesktop.org/dbus/dbus/refs/tags' | \ - $(SED) -n "s,.*]*\)\.tar.*,\1,p' | \ - head -1 + $(WGET) -q -O- 'ftp://ftp.unidata.ucar.edu/pub/netcdf/old/' | \ + $(SED) -n 's,.*netcdf-\([0-9]\.[^>]*\)\.tar.*,\1,p' | \ + $(SORT) -V | \ + tail -1 endef ifeq ($(MXE_WINDOWS_BUILD),yes) diff -r 91cbefb72c40 -r 7e8c6bb47c21 src/protobuf.mk --- a/src/protobuf.mk Wed Nov 29 11:01:36 2017 -0500 +++ b/src/protobuf.mk Wed Nov 29 15:50:53 2017 -0500 @@ -4,16 +4,16 @@ PKG := protobuf $(PKG)_IGNORE := $(PKG)_VERSION := 2.4.1 -$(PKG)_CHECKSUM := df5867e37a4b51fb69f53a8baf5b994938691d6d +$(PKG)_CHECKSUM := e0138dd2d8fd2433508838bb4aab4db926a0d6fe $(PKG)_SUBDIR := $(PKG)-$($(PKG)_VERSION) -$(PKG)_FILE := $(PKG)-$($(PKG)_VERSION).tar.bz2 -$(PKG)_URL := http://protobuf.googlecode.com/files/$($(PKG)_FILE) +$(PKG)_FILE := $(PKG)-$($(PKG)_VERSION).tar.gz +$(PKG)_URL := https://github.com/google/$(PKG)/archive/v$($(PKG)_VERSION).tar.gz $(PKG)_DEPS := zlib define $(PKG)_UPDATE - $(WGET) -q -O- 'http://code.google.com/p/protobuf/downloads/list?sort=-uploaded' | \ - $(SED) -n 's,.*protobuf-\([0-9][^<]*\)\.tar.*,\1,p' | \ - head -1 + $(WGET) -q -O- 'https://github.com/google/protobuf/tags' | \ + $(SED) -n 's|.*releases/tag/v\([^"]*\).*|\1|p' | $(SORT) -V | \ + tail -1 endef define $(PKG)_BUILD